R坑二:Warning: cannot remove prior installation of package ‘digest’

安装TxDb.Hsapiens.UCSC.hg19.knownGene包,报错...

> BiocManager::install("TxDb.Hsapiens.UCSC.hg19.knownGene")
Bioconductor version 3.8 (BiocManager 1.30.8), R 3.5.1 (2018-07-02)
Installing package(s) 'TxDb.Hsapiens.UCSC.hg19.knownGene'
installing the source package ‘TxDb.Hsapiens.UCSC.hg19.knownGene’

trying URL 'https://bioconductor.org/packages/3.8/data/annotation/src/contrib/TxDb.Hsapiens.UCSC.hg19.knownGene_3.2.2.tar.gz'
Content type 'application/x-gzip' length 18669702 bytes (17.8 MB)
downloaded 17.8 MB

* installing *source* package 'TxDb.Hsapiens.UCSC.hg19.knownGene' ...
** R
** inst
** byte-compile and prepare package for lazy loading
Warning: package 'GenomicFeatures' was built under R version 3.5.3
Warning: package 'GenomeInfoDb' was built under R version 3.5.2
Error: package or namespace load failed for 'AnnotationDbi' in loadNamespace(j <- i[[1L]], c(lib.loc, .libPaths()), versionCheck = vI[[j]]):
 there is no package called 'digest'
Error : package 'AnnotationDbi' could not be loaded
ERROR: lazy loading failed for package 'TxDb.Hsapiens.UCSC.hg19.knownGene'
* removing 'C:/Users/zhangdengwei/Documents/R/win-library/3.5/TxDb.Hsapiens.UCSC.hg19.knownGene'
In R CMD INSTALL

The downloaded source packages are in
    ‘C:\Users\zhangdengwei\AppData\Local\Temp\RtmpIDBXB0\downloaded_packages’
Installation path not writeable, unable to update packages: boot, class, cluster, codetools, foreign,
  KernSmooth, lattice, MASS, Matrix, mgcv, nlme, rpart, survival
Warning message:
In install.packages(...) :
  installation of package ‘TxDb.Hsapiens.UCSC.hg19.knownGene’ had non-zero exit status

提示没有包digest没有,安装...

> library("digest")
Error in library("digest") : 不存在叫‘digest’这个名字的程辑包
> BiocManager::install("digest")
Bioconductor version 3.8 (BiocManager 1.30.8), R 3.5.1 (2018-07-02)
Installing package(s) 'digest'

  There is a binary version available but the source version is later:
       binary source needs_compilation
digest 0.6.21 0.6.22              TRUE

  Binaries will be installed
trying URL 'https://cran.csiro.au/bin/windows/contrib/3.5/digest_0.6.21.zip'
Content type 'application/zip' length 237366 bytes (231 KB)
downloaded 231 KB

package ‘digest’ successfully unpacked and MD5 sums checked
Warning: cannot remove prior installation of package ‘digest’

The downloaded binary packages are in
    C:\Users\zhangdengwei\AppData\Local\Temp\RtmpIDBXB0\downloaded_packages
Installation path not writeable, unable to update packages: boot, class, cluster, codetools, foreign,
  KernSmooth, lattice, MASS, Matrix, mgcv, nlme, rpart, survival

提示Warning: cannot remove prior installation of package ‘digest’,迷糊了,没有咋个说不能删除之前的包
查看下是否有之前的digest包,可以通过以下方式找到本地存放R包的位置

image.png

还是Tools -> Install Packages,找到目录,只有今天安装的一个包
image.png

删掉,重启Rstudio,再次测试

> library("digest")
Error in library("digest") : 不存在叫‘digest’这个名字的程辑包
> BiocManager::install("digest")
Bioconductor version 3.8 (BiocManager 1.30.8), ?BiocManager::install for help
Bioconductor version '3.8' is out-of-date; the current release version '3.9' is available with R version
  '3.6'; see https://bioconductor.org/install
Bioconductor version 3.8 (BiocManager 1.30.8), R 3.5.1 (2018-07-02)
Installing package(s) 'digest'

  There is a binary version available but the source version is later:
       binary source needs_compilation
digest 0.6.21 0.6.22              TRUE

  Binaries will be installed
trying URL 'https://cran.csiro.au/bin/windows/contrib/3.5/digest_0.6.21.zip'
Content type 'application/zip' length 237366 bytes (231 KB)
downloaded 231 KB

package ‘digest’ successfully unpacked and MD5 sums checked

The downloaded binary packages are in
    C:\Users\zhangdengwei\AppData\Local\Temp\RtmpiAHo7v\downloaded_packages
Installation path not writeable, unable to update packages: boot, class, cluster, codetools, foreign,
  KernSmooth, lattice, MASS, Matrix, mgcv, nlme, rpart, survival
Old packages: 'digest'
Update all/some/none? [a/s/n]: 
a

  There is a binary version available but the source version is later:
       binary source needs_compilation
digest 0.6.21 0.6.22              TRUE

  Binaries will be installed
trying URL 'https://cran.csiro.au/bin/windows/contrib/3.5/digest_0.6.21.zip'
Content type 'application/zip' length 237366 bytes (231 KB)
downloaded 231 KB

package ‘digest’ successfully unpacked and MD5 sums checked

The downloaded binary packages are in
    C:\Users\zhangdengwei\AppData\Local\Temp\RtmpiAHo7v\downloaded_packages
> library("digest")
Warning message:
程辑包‘digest’是用R版本3.5.3 来建造的 

果然成功了,R真是谜一样的软件,再次安装

> BiocManager::install("TxDb.Hsapiens.UCSC.hg19.knownGene")
Bioconductor version 3.8 (BiocManager 1.30.8), R 3.5.1 (2018-07-02)
Installing package(s) 'TxDb.Hsapiens.UCSC.hg19.knownGene'
installing the source package ‘TxDb.Hsapiens.UCSC.hg19.knownGene’

trying URL 'https://bioconductor.org/packages/3.8/data/annotation/src/contrib/TxDb.Hsapiens.UCSC.hg19.knownGene_3.2.2.tar.gz'
Content type 'application/x-gzip' length 18669702 bytes (17.8 MB)
downloaded 17.8 MB

* installing *source* package 'TxDb.Hsapiens.UCSC.hg19.knownGene' ...
** R
** inst
** byte-compile and prepare package for lazy loading
Warning: package 'GenomicFeatures' was built under R version 3.5.3
Warning: package 'GenomeInfoDb' was built under R version 3.5.2
** help
*** installing help indices
  converting help for package 'TxDb.Hsapiens.UCSC.hg19.knownGene'
    finding HTML links ... 好了
    package                                 html  
** building package indices
** testing if installed package can be loaded
Warning: package 'GenomicFeatures' was built under R version 3.5.3
Warning: package 'GenomeInfoDb' was built under R version 3.5.2
* DONE (TxDb.Hsapiens.UCSC.hg19.knownGene)
In R CMD INSTALL

The downloaded source packages are in
    ‘C:\Users\zhangdengwei\AppData\Local\Temp\RtmpiAHo7v\downloaded_packages’
Installation path not writeable, unable to update packages: boot, class, cluster, codetools, foreign,
  KernSmooth, lattice, MASS, Matrix, mgcv, nlme, rpart, survival
Old packages: 'digest'
Update all/some/none? [a/s/n]: 
a

  There is a binary version available but the source version is later:
       binary source needs_compilation
digest 0.6.21 0.6.22              TRUE

  Binaries will be installed
Warning: package ‘digest’ is in use and will not be installed
> library("TxDb.Hsapiens.UCSC.hg19.knownGene")
载入需要的程辑包:GenomicFeatures
载入需要的程辑包:BiocGenerics
载入需要的程辑包:parallel

载入程辑包:‘BiocGenerics’

The following objects are masked from ‘package:parallel’:

    clusterApply, clusterApplyLB, clusterCall, clusterEvalQ, clusterExport, clusterMap, parApply,
    parCapply, parLapply, parLapplyLB, parRapply, parSapply, parSapplyLB

The following objects are masked from ‘package:stats’:

    IQR, mad, sd, var, xtabs

The following objects are masked from ‘package:base’:

    anyDuplicated, append, as.data.frame, basename, cbind, colMeans, colnames, colSums, dirname,
    do.call, duplicated, eval, evalq, Filter, Find, get, grep, grepl, intersect, is.unsorted,
    lapply, lengths, Map, mapply, match, mget, order, paste, pmax, pmax.int, pmin, pmin.int,
    Position, rank, rbind, Reduce, rowMeans, rownames, rowSums, sapply, setdiff, sort, table,
    tapply, union, unique, unsplit, which, which.max, which.min

载入需要的程辑包:S4Vectors
载入需要的程辑包:stats4

载入程辑包:‘S4Vectors’

The following object is masked from ‘package:base’:

    expand.grid

载入需要的程辑包:IRanges

载入程辑包:‘IRanges’

The following object is masked from ‘package:grDevices’:

    windows

载入需要的程辑包:GenomeInfoDb
载入需要的程辑包:GenomicRanges
载入需要的程辑包:AnnotationDbi
载入需要的程辑包:Biobase
Welcome to Bioconductor

    Vignettes contain introductory material; view with 'browseVignettes()'. To cite Bioconductor,
    see 'citation("Biobase")', and for packages 'citation("pkgname")'.

Warning messages:
1: 程辑包‘GenomicFeatures’是用R版本3.5.3 来建造的 
2: 程辑包‘GenomeInfoDb’是用R版本3.5.2 来建造的 

成功...

©著作权归作者所有,转载或内容合作请联系作者
  • 序言:七十年代末,一起剥皮案震惊了整个滨河市,随后出现的几起案子,更是在滨河造成了极大的恐慌,老刑警刘岩,带你破解...
    沈念sama阅读 199,636评论 5 468
  • 序言:滨河连续发生了三起死亡事件,死亡现场离奇诡异,居然都是意外死亡,警方通过查阅死者的电脑和手机,发现死者居然都...
    沈念sama阅读 83,890评论 2 376
  • 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
    开封第一讲书人阅读 146,680评论 0 330
  • 文/不坏的土叔 我叫张陵,是天一观的道长。 经常有香客问我,道长,这世上最难降的妖魔是什么? 我笑而不...
    开封第一讲书人阅读 53,766评论 1 271
  • 正文 为了忘掉前任,我火速办了婚礼,结果婚礼上,老公的妹妹穿的比我还像新娘。我一直安慰自己,他们只是感情好,可当我...
    茶点故事阅读 62,665评论 5 359
  • 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
    开封第一讲书人阅读 48,045评论 1 276
  • 那天,我揣着相机与录音,去河边找鬼。 笑死,一个胖子当着我的面吹牛,可吹牛的内容都是我干的。 我是一名探鬼主播,决...
    沈念sama阅读 37,515评论 3 390
  • 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
    开封第一讲书人阅读 36,182评论 0 254
  • 序言:老挝万荣一对情侣失踪,失踪者是张志新(化名)和其女友刘颖,没想到半个月后,有当地人在树林里发现了一具尸体,经...
    沈念sama阅读 40,334评论 1 294
  • 正文 独居荒郊野岭守林人离奇死亡,尸身上长有42处带血的脓包…… 初始之章·张勋 以下内容为张勋视角 年9月15日...
    茶点故事阅读 35,274评论 2 317
  • 正文 我和宋清朗相恋三年,在试婚纱的时候发现自己被绿了。 大学时的朋友给我发了我未婚夫和他白月光在一起吃饭的照片。...
    茶点故事阅读 37,319评论 1 329
  • 序言:一个原本活蹦乱跳的男人离奇死亡,死状恐怖,灵堂内的尸体忽然破棺而出,到底是诈尸还是另有隐情,我是刑警宁泽,带...
    沈念sama阅读 33,002评论 3 315
  • 正文 年R本政府宣布,位于F岛的核电站,受9级特大地震影响,放射性物质发生泄漏。R本人自食恶果不足惜,却给世界环境...
    茶点故事阅读 38,599评论 3 303
  • 文/蒙蒙 一、第九天 我趴在偏房一处隐蔽的房顶上张望。 院中可真热闹,春花似锦、人声如沸。这庄子的主人今日做“春日...
    开封第一讲书人阅读 29,675评论 0 19
  • 文/苍兰香墨 我抬头看了看天上的太阳。三九已至,却和暖如春,着一层夹袄步出监牢的瞬间,已是汗流浃背。 一阵脚步声响...
    开封第一讲书人阅读 30,917评论 1 255
  • 我被黑心中介骗来泰国打工, 没想到刚下飞机就差点儿被人妖公主榨干…… 1. 我叫王不留,地道东北人。 一个月前我还...
    沈念sama阅读 42,309评论 2 345
  • 正文 我出身青楼,却偏偏与公主长得像,于是被迫代替她去往敌国和亲。 传闻我的和亲对象是个残疾皇子,可洞房花烛夜当晚...
    茶点故事阅读 41,885评论 2 341

推荐阅读更多精彩内容